Montreal duo Biochip return to Central Processing Unit with their new LP Crux Alley. The pair of Melissa Speirs and Julian Kochanowski turned plenty of heads when they first rocked up on the Sheffield label back in 2019 with debut drop Synthase. Synthase found Biochip twisting up Braindance, IDM and electro to their own ends, and Crux Alley is an album which hits similar sonic sweet-spots.
It's clear from the off that Biochip have brought their A-game here. Opener 'Mind Bubbles' has no time for pleasantries, dropping the listener straight into a nocturnal IDM-electro groove where bass dances nervily around shadowy synth pads. 'Mind Bubbles' is followed-up 'Polymorphic State', a tune whose laser-gun synth-bass plumbs even more energy into the pair's Rephlex-indebted sound. It's a hugely arresting way to begin an album, and the bold sonics here align Crux Alley with recent CPU releases like Bit Folder's Silicon Frontier and Annie Hall's Fum.
Other tracks on Crux Alley ease up on the frenzied feel of those opening numbers. Take 'Orbital Rendezvous', a cut which is still full of zippy melodies and keening keyboards but whose contemplative strut recalls the legendary electronic music duo referenced in the track's title. There's also a distinct cyberpunk flavour to this track, and this is brought out further on the vivid 'Dopamine City' and 'Tower 13' - it is at these points where Biochip most resemble the work of fellow CPU act B12.
Biochip record their music straight from the mixing desk, an approach that gives their tracks a spontaneous energy and one which sometimes leads Speirs and Kochanowski into novel sonic terrain. Crux Alley's 'Antagonist Part 6', for instance, is a spiritual successor to Synthase's 'Acid Billy' in how the overload of electronics almost pushes it into industrial-techno territory. Furthermore, while most of the LP draws on the Detroit electro continuum of Drexciya, DJ Stingray et al, 'Neutral Current' obliquely recalls the jazz-tinged house of Theo Parrish - although the wobbling synth chords and reverb-laced drums make 'Neutral Current' sound more like an extra-terrestrial reimagining of the Motor City legend's music.
Biochip continue to mark themselves out as one of contemporary electro's most exciting new acts with the Crux Alley LP.
Riyl: Cygnus, B12, Annie Hall, Orbital, Silicon Scally

With 3 releases under their belt Council Work return with the 4th installment on the label, the 'Crouching Tiger EP'. Sticking with the formula of the last EP, there are 2 originals from the label owners themselves Frankel & Harper, coming in the form of stripped back UKG number 'Crouching Tiger' as the A1, and then bringing heavyweight moodiness on the A2 with 'Conquering Lion'. First up on remix duties on the B1 is Italian producer, DJ and Music On regular Leon with a dubby, rolling take on the title track. Hotly tipped UKG producer ZeroFG steps up to remix the B2 and brings some serious dub reggae vibes mixed with some rude garage flavours to round off the EP and give a great contrast to the original.

Bristol based artist, Sunun with a killer 6 track EP - the first 12" of the year on Idle Hands (ran by Chris Farrell) . A member of the city's Young Echo collective she has made waves with her abstracted take on dub for Bokeh Versions and Cold Light Music, gaining praise from Adrian Sherwood along the way. Her most recent release was a collaborative EP with Giant Swan’s Robin Stewart. Over these six tracks we are invited into her sonic world, described by the artist herself as “a step towards rhythm tracks, with shallower themes and confidence, with priority to the ancient components; the drum and voice” Adventurous, brooding and unique - this is an EP you need to hear. Proceeds from the EP will go to Ace, a charity organising 1:1 music sessions with teenagers in the local area where Sunun has been doing work.

‘Soy Piccolo’ is the firecracker debut EP from Sydney DJ/producer Unpin. Comprised of 6 high-energy dancefloor bombs, the EP traverses a broad range of sounds through acid-house, electro and experimental club cuts.
On this release, Unpin’s work is heavy on breaks and 303’s, balanced by a subtle pop sensibility with precision-picked vocal cuts tying the release together. All killer, no filler, the release is a gritty, yet confident body of work from one of Sydney’s most promising rising stars.
This is the debut release from Sydney imprint and party collective Velodrome. Released digitally in mid-March, the record has garnered attention online including blog coverage on Resident Advisor, Purple Sneakers and Colors Studios. The two singles from the record have also received consistent airplay on two of Australia’s largest independent radio stations, Triple J and FBi.

A generation younger than the founders of the Teklife crew, DJ Rashad and DJ Spinn, DJ Taye was originally a rapper and beat maker before hooking up with the collective and jumping into the world of footwork production and DJing. However, it was Rashad’s untimely passing in 2014 that was the unlikely catalyst for developing the sounds and ideas for this album. He says, "When Rashad passed away I felt inspired to continue evolving the music that I loved so much coming up in this world. So, I had to do something…make something brand new." 100% committed to pushing further the potential of the footwork template, Still Trippin’ is ambitious in its range and scope. Taking two years to formulate, the record broadens the possibilities of the sound, forcing it to adapt to songwriting, and also revives Taye’s talent for MCing and producing beats to which he can rap and sing. Furthermore Taye definitely ups the ante with his complex and precise drum programming, never losing sight of footwork’s ability to confound. The album features a range of guests that span contemporary music; the eccentric, instructive rapping of Chuck Inglish of Detroit duo the Cool Kids is featured on ‘Get It Jukin’, Odile Myrtil, a young vocalist from Montreal, lends her smokey soul to ‘Same Sound’, Fabi Reyna, the editor of the celebrated women’s guitar magazine She Shreds, sings and plays bass and rhythm guitar on ‘I Don’t Know’ and Jersey club queen UNIIQU3 offers production and rapping on ‘Gimme Some Mo’.Also, Teklife members DJ PayPal and DJ Manny assist on production, and DJ Lucky is a guest MC on ‘Smokeout’. Taye is ambitious in his hopes for the album; "I took this as an opportunity to not have boundaries with footwork. Different approaches to our ‘underground’ sound to make it broader. It’s only underground until it crosses that visible threshold.” This album brings all of this to the forefront.

Established Berlin based producer Carsten Aermes, aka PHON.O, delivers his latest EP ‘Afterglow’, bringing the Vorsprung Durch (to) Tectonic. Having dropped a number of acclaimed releases on Modeselektor’s dynamic imprint 50 Weapons over the last several years, PHON.O has also had a variety of singles and EPs for the likes of Kompact, BPitch, Shitkatapult and Detroit Underground, as well as remixes galore.

‘Mercurial’ kick starts the EP at 137bpm, melting the boundaries between techno, dubstep and footwork with effortless grace. The track sets a mood with an initial sense of ominous tension, before embarking on a strange, cosmic journey, narrated by polyrhythmic layers of percussive interplay. Kick drums bounce, snares crack, hats and the melody builds with mysterious intent.

Flip over then for the first of two further tales in dubwise beat science. First up is ‘U8 Phunk’, taking it’s name in part from a Berlin underground metro line, it represents a tougher, harder edge to the EP. Recalling echo’s of jungle music alongside techno sensibilities, ‘U8 Phunk’ follows on again at 137bpm with a series of hyperactive drum hits and twisting percussive manoeuvres, charged with a reese-like bassline and grimy bass stabs.

‘Bell Blender’ closes off the EP, further developing themes of broken breakbeats and grimy sci-fi atmospherics, this time at a tempo more accessible to techno dancefloors. Dubbed and spacious, smattered with crashing remnants of breakbeats and scorching synth sonics - it’s a fine way to round things off!

B.Riddim is Luis Sequeira, a Portuguese living in London. Magic My Ear is his second ep for Third Ear, following the (In) Theory ep in 2012. Formerly a driving force in the influential Portuguese rap group G-Ward under the name Bellatur, Luis followed his love of Jamaican Dub using electronics to arrive at a sound which is identifiable through the sum of its parts but which is quite unique. Music like this might reasonably be expected to come from Bristol, given Bristol's musical history. The 4/4 groove is slightly more emphasized here than the tracks on (in Theory) but it is a subtle pulse most of the time with the bass and drums providing the groove and the rhythms under cascading old-skool rave melodies and arpeggios, with live melodica played by Luis. Dub and psychedelic sensibilities are to the fore on Transformed Love and Magic My Ear, carefully controlled acid-house echoes through the towering bass and whiplash drums of Dropping Your Soul. Twisted electronica floats a nd weaves through the rolling bass of Left Side.

The second of the Decadub vinyl-only releases dedicates three of its four sides to a volley of woozy and twisted footwork from most of the key members of Chicago's Teklife crew. Side One starts with DJ Rashad and Gant Man's squiggly 303 banger 'Acid Life' and moves onto Taso & Djunya's Darwinian banger 'Only The Strong Will Survive'. Side Two descends into DJ Spinn's bombastic 'All My Teklife' and then Earl, Rashad & Taye's 'Bombaklot' which takes Hyperdub full circle with a yardcore bomb like a 2014 upgrade of the label's early days. Side Three leads with DJ Earl's immaculate diva vocal cut-up of 'I'm Gonna Get You', then moves on into DJ Taye's fizzling R&B jam 'Get Em Up’ and the stone cold, warped humour of 'Icemaster' by Heavee. On the fourth and final side, Tokyo-based ally Quarta330 returns to craft ‘Hanabi’, an epic, uptempo synthesiser jam. Young gun Champion follows with ‘Power Cut’, its minimal, energetic and militant kicks and bass molded with cowbell and lots of tight edits, before dropping some neat keys and a warping bassline two thirds in. Ikonika finishes things off with the solemn march of 'Tug Zone', opening slow but building in flickering high hats and gaseous cymbals into a track which could have emanated from Battlestar Galactica.

Fatima's debut album is called ‘Asiatisch’, and as the track titles suggest, the record provides a simulated road trip through an imagined China. Musically, the album is an homage to that quietly influential sub-strain of grime, often loosely termed 'sinogrime' due to its preoccupation with Asian motifs and melodies, pioneered by the likes of Wiley and Jammer at the beginning of the 2000s in East London.

'Asiatisch' is a provocation which asks more questions than it answers. The title is the German word for Asian. Unlike its title, however, the music on 'Asiatisch' revolves around the fantasies of East Asia as refracted through pulpy Western pop culture, in particular Hollywood, literary fiction, music, cartoons and advertising. Fatima asks what is meant by the term 'Asian' in a digital age of viral interchange and the hi-speed trading of cultural bytes; the concept of 'shanzhai' proves pivotal, a term whose meaning stems from a wild, out of control zone of banditry, but which has come to be used to refer to the Chinese counterfeiting of Western brands and goods.

While a number of producers have made takes on 'sinogrime' over the last few years, 'Asiatisch' is really the first record that attempts to articulate this weird complex of sonic interchanges between the West and China.

Finnish producer Desto returns to Rwina to deliver his first full length album, ‘Emptier Streets’. As with his previous releases on the Dutch label, Desto strips the music back to its bare-bone essentials, fulfilling the album’s title with a sound that’s spacious and eerie, bleak and punishing yet still offers warmth in its apparent coldness. Stylistically the album is most obviously aligned with the aesthetics of Dirty South hip hop and the dubstep diaspora, deploying booming drums, rolling hats and cold synthetic melodies and voices inside cavernous sonic landscapes.
